The position
As a Mid-Level/Senior Payroll & Benefits Operations (PBO) Specialist with French or Italian, you will provide professional payroll and benefits services to Line of Business (LoB) in EMEA region. In particular you will be responsible for supporting and coordinating the end-to-end payroll process (EMEA countries) while ensuring accurate and timely delivery of remuneration to Novo Nordisk employees.

About the department
EMEA Regional Service Centre (RSC EMEA) is co-located with the Business Area office for Europe East, the Polish affiliate, DD&IT department and Clinical Development Center (CDC). With annual budgeted sales level of over 700 million DKK the company ambition is to continuously improve quality of patients’ life and bring innovation into the markets.
The RSC EMEA is formed by two departments – AskHR (HR administration and employee support) and Payroll, Development & Operations (PBO, project and systems management). The payroll department (PBO) delivers payroll and benefits support to countries like France, Germany, Italy, Sweden, Ireland and UK.
